UAE: Pakistanis Top Best Drivers List Of 2020

Yallacompare, a pioneering insurance platform in the UAE, has named Pakistani drivers to be the safest in terms of road accidents. Examining the data by customer nationality, the company revealed that Pakistani drivers were found to be the best drivers with just 2.5% of them having made a claim in the past one year, reported Khaleej Times. Lebanese, Filipino, Syrian and Jordanian drivers secured the second, third, fourth and fifth spots, respectively. “It’s interesting to discover that according to our user-declared data, Pakistani drivers were the best in the UAE in 2020, from the point of view of making insurance claims,” said Jonathan Rawling, CFO, Yallacompare.

 

Moreover, in 2020, only 3.8% of Yallacompare customers declared that they had made a claim on their car insurance in the last 12 months compared to 8% in 2019. “The most important thing for insurance buyers to understand, however, is that it is essential to ensure that anything you declare to an insurance company or broker is true. If any statements are later found to be false, any claim could be reduced or denied. Never attempt to save money by making incorrect statements,” Rawling added.

The Covid-19 pandemic can be viewed as one of the main reasons for the reduction in the number of claims last year. This is because a fewer number of people were driving last year due to the long-lasting lockdown and the implementation of a work-from-home policy by the public and private sectors. “While it would be fantastic news to suggest the lower claim figure is down to a remarkable increase in safer driving, it’s pretty safe to say the lower number of claims is more likely to be attributable to less travel and lower car usage due to the virus lockdown, curfews imposed and working from home,” Rawling concluded.
